Corporation to hold artsand sports competitions

The event will be held from November 17 to 20

November 06, 2018 12:33 am | Updated 12:33 am IST - THIRUVANANTHAPURAM

The city Corporation has invited applications from city residents who are interested in participating in the arts and sports competitions for those above the age of 35, to be organised by the local body.

The events will be held from November 17 to 20. The applications have to reach the Corporation’s education and sports standing committee before November 14.

In athletics, one person can participate in three individual events, in addition to relay.

For group events, a separate list of all the team members, including documents proving their age and address is needed.

Athletic events

The athletic events will be held for men and women in the age groups of 35- 40 , 40- 45, 45- 50, 50- 55, 55- 60, 60- 65, 65- 70 and above 75.

For those between the ages of 45 and 60, the competitions will be held in 100m, 200m, 400m, 800m and 1500 m running, 2 km walking, long jump, shot put, javelin throw, 4x100 relay and 4x400 relay.

For those above the age of 60, competitions will be in 100m, 200m, 400m and 800m running, 2 km walking, long jump, shot put, javelin throw, 4x100 relay and 4x400 relay.

For shuttle events in the age groups 35-45, 45-60 and above the age of 60, there will be separate competitions for men and women. The age of the competitors will be the age as on October 31 this year.

Art competitions

In the art competitions, one person can take part only in three individual events, other than group events.

Any medium can be chosen for the painting competition.

The Corporation will provide the chart paper. The competitors need to bring painting materials.

The local body will also provide the material for toy making competition.

The other competitions are in folk song, group song, katha prasangam, street play, violin, guitar, tabla, flute, light music, mimicry, poetry recital and sculpture making.
